摘 要:建筑遮阳作为人们抵御太阳辐射的主要手段,不仅是建筑节约能耗的主要举措,也是一种新的建筑造型手法和设计思路,甚至是表达建筑本身地域性、文化性的重要媒介手段之一。然而,我国的建筑遮阳设计仍然存在一些问题,如遮阳材料及形式单一,遮阳与通风、采光、视线等其他功能的矛盾,与建筑造型缺乏整体考虑等。文中提出复合化的遮阳设计策略,分别从遮阳的功能、造型、材料技术及地域性几个方面进行论述,指出建筑遮阳呈现越来越综合化、智能化、地域化的发展趋势。Architectural shading, as the main means for people to resist the solar radiation, it is not only the main measure to save energy, but also a kind of architecture modeling techniques and design ideas, and even one of the most important means of expression of the building itself, the regional culture. Architectural shading design in our country, however, are still exist some problems, such as the single shading material and form, the contradiction between shading and other functions such as ventilation, lighting, the line of sight, and the lack of an overall consideration with architectural modeling and so on. Therefore, the paper proposes a composite shade design strategy, separately discusses from the shade function, form, material technology and regional aspects, and points out the development trend of architectural shading is more and more integrated, intelligent, regionalization.
